Bungie.net’s support of File Shares & Stats will be frozen on March 31st, and then some changes will occur on this site on April 1st and the rest in Summer.
The reason the Reach stats are not functioning on bungie.net now is due to some errors on their end as confirmed here: http://www.bungie.net/Forums/posts.aspx?postID=69884343.
File Share support though, will be added here during Summer.
